Discovering iCollege Football Camps
Finding iCollege football camps requires a strategic approach. Start by leveraging online resources. Websites like NCSA Sports, ESPN Recruiting, and 247Sports often list upcoming camps and showcases. Use search engines with specific keywords such as "iCollege football camps near [your city]" or "best football camps for college recruiting in [your state]." Don't forget to check the official websites of colleges and universities in your region, as they frequently host their own football camps led by their coaching staff. Social media platforms, like Twitter and Facebook, can also be valuable resources. Many camps and recruiting services actively promote their events on these channels.
Talk to your high school coach and athletic director. They usually have connections and insights into reputable iCollege football camps. Your coach can provide recommendations based on your skill level and college aspirations. Networking with current and former players can also provide valuable information. They can share their experiences and offer advice on which camps are worth attending. College recruiting events and combines are other excellent avenues to explore. These events often feature representatives from various colleges, offering a chance to showcase your talents and learn about different camp opportunities. Remember to research each camp thoroughly. Look at the coaching staff, facilities, and the track record of players who have attended in the past. A well-informed decision will ensure you choose a camp that aligns with your goals and helps you progress in your football journey.
What to Look for in a Top-Notch Camp
When evaluating iCollege football camps, several factors can distinguish a great camp from a mediocre one. The quality of the coaching staff is paramount. Look for camps led by experienced coaches with a proven track record of developing players. College coaches or former professional players can provide invaluable insights and training techniques. The camp's structure and curriculum should be well-organized and focused on skill development. A good camp will offer position-specific training, film study sessions, and opportunities for live game simulations. Individualized attention is also crucial. The best camps maintain a low player-to-coach ratio, allowing for personalized feedback and guidance. This ensures that each player receives the attention they need to improve.
Assess the facilities and resources available at the iCollege football camp. High-quality fields, training equipment, and medical support are essential for a safe and productive learning environment. The camp should also prioritize player safety, with certified athletic trainers on-site and protocols in place for injury prevention and management. Exposure to college recruiters is a significant benefit of attending iCollege football camps. The camp should have a strong network of college coaches who regularly attend to evaluate talent. Opportunities to interact with these coaches and showcase your skills can significantly increase your chances of getting recruited. Finally, consider the camp's reputation and testimonials from past attendees. Look for reviews and feedback that highlight the camp's effectiveness and overall experience. A reputable camp will have a history of helping players achieve their goals and advance their football careers. By carefully evaluating these factors, you can identify an iCollege football camp that will provide the best possible training and exposure.

Preparing for Your iCollege Football Camp
Proper preparation is key to maximizing your experience at iCollege football camps. Start by developing a comprehensive training plan. Focus on improving your strength, speed, agility, and position-specific skills. Consult with your coach or a personal trainer to create a workout routine that aligns with your goals. Nutrition and hydration are also crucial. Fuel your body with a balanced diet that includes plenty of protein, carbohydrates, and healthy fats.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day, especially during intense training sessions.
Familiarize yourself with the camp's schedule and curriculum. Understand the types of drills and activities you'll be participating in so you can mentally prepare. Review your position-specific techniques and study film of yourself to identify areas for improvement. Pack appropriately for the iCollege football camp. Bring all necessary football gear, including cleats, pads, helmet, and practice jerseys. Don't forget essentials like sunscreen, a hat, and a water bottle. A positive mindset is essential for success. Approach the camp with a willingness to learn, a strong work ethic, and a positive attitude. Be open to feedback from coaches and be prepared to push yourself outside of your comfort zone. Set realistic goals for the camp. Focus on improving specific skills and showcasing your strengths. Don't get discouraged if you don't perform perfectly. Use the experience as an opportunity to learn and grow. By preparing thoroughly, you can ensure that you get the most out of your iCollege football camp experience and set yourself up for success.
